Overview

The ScreenBeam ECB6250 Bonded MoCA Network Adapter is a versatile solution designed to extend a home or office network by leveraging existing coaxial cabling. This adapter allows users to establish an Ethernet internet port wherever a coaxial connection is available, providing a simple and flexible way to expand network access without the need for new wiring.

Function Description:

The primary function of the ECB6250 is to convert an internet signal from a broadband modem or router into a MoCA (Multimedia over Coax Alliance) signal, which is then transmitted over the coaxial network. Conversely, it can receive a MoCA signal from the coaxial network and convert it back into an Ethernet signal for connected devices. This enables high-speed internet access in locations that might otherwise be difficult or costly to wire with Ethernet cables. The adapter supports MoCA 2.5, offering robust performance for demanding network applications.

Important Technical Specifications:

  • Model Number: ECB6250 (MoCA 2.5 Network Adapter)
  • IP: LAN MoCA (v. 2.5; up to 2.5 Gbps throughput), LAN Ethernet Port 10/100/1000 (1)
  • LAN Connections: Coax In Frequency Range - Extended D-band: 1125MHz ~ 1675MHz
  • LED Indicators: Power, Coax
  • Power: External, 5V DC, 2A, 1.3 mm diameter connector plug (Made by APD, model #WB-10E05FU)
  • Regulatory Compliance: FCC, UL 60950-1, CUL, IC
  • Environmental Conditions:
    • Ambient temperature: 0°C to 40°C (32°F to 104°F)
    • Storage temperature: -20°C to 85°C (-4°F to 185°F)
    • Operating humidity: 10% to 85% non-condensing
    • Storage humidity: 5% to 90% non-condensing

Usage Features:

The ECB6250 is designed for ease of use, with a straightforward setup process.

  • Package Contents: Each unit comes with the ECB6250 MoCA 2.5 Network Adapter, a coaxial cable, a power adapter, a Quick Start Guide, and an Ethernet cable.
  • Requirements: Installation requires an available coaxial port and an available electrical wall socket in the desired installation areas.
  • Connectivity: It features a 1.0 gigabit Ethernet port and a Coax In coaxial port (v. 2.5).
  • LED Indicators: The device includes LED indicators for Power, Coax, and Ethernet status.
    • Power LED: Glows solid green when the adapter is powered up.
    • Coax LED: Glows solid green when there is a connection on the Coax port.
    • Ethernet LEDs (2): Located on the upper right and left corners of the Ethernet port. The left LED glows green on connection, and the right LED blinks green when data is transferred across the port.
  • First Adapter Setup: The initial adapter connects to the broadband modem/router and the coaxial network. This involves connecting a coaxial cable from a coaxial outlet to the adapter's Coax In port, an Ethernet cable from the modem/router's Ethernet port to the adapter's Ethernet port, and then plugging in the power adapter.
  • Additional Adapter Setup: For extending the network to other areas, additional adapters can be installed. This process mirrors the first adapter setup: connect a coaxial cable from a coaxial outlet to the adapter's Coax In port, an Ethernet cable from the adapter's Ethernet port to the device needing internet access (e.g., computer, smart TV), and then plug in the power adapter.
  • Coaxial Splitter Use: If a coaxial port is already in use by another device (like a set-top box), a 2-way coaxial splitter (not included) can be used. The existing coaxial cable from the wall outlet connects to the "In" port of the splitter. One "Out" port connects to the original device, and the other "Out" port connects to the ECB6250 adapter.
  • MoCA Protected Setup (MPS): By default, MoCA encryption is disabled. To enable it, users can log into the adapter's firmware via a web browser (http://192.168.144.200) using "admin" as the username and "actiontec" as the password. Once enabled, the MPS push button on the adapter can be used to synchronize the encryption password across all connected MoCA 2.5 adapters.

Maintenance Features:

  • Cleaning: The device should only be cleaned with a dry cloth.
  • Ventilation: Do not block any ventilation openings to prevent overheating.
  • Heat Sources: Avoid installing the adapter near heat sources such as radiators, heat registers, stoves, or other heat-producing apparatus like amplifiers.
  • Water Exposure: Do not use the product near water (e.g., bathtub, kitchen sink, laundry tub, swimming pool, or in a wet basement).
  • Power Cord and Batteries: Use only the power cord and batteries indicated in the manual. Batteries should be disposed of in fire-safe locations according to local codes.
  • Coaxial Cable Shield: Ensure the coaxial cable screen shield is connected to the Earth at the building entrance per ANSI/NFPA 70, the National Electrical Code (NEC), in particular Section 820.93, "Grounding of Outer Conductive Shield of a Coaxial Cable," or in accordance with local regulation.
  • Troubleshooting: The user guide provides basic troubleshooting information, and further support, firmware updates, and FAQs are available on the ScreenBeam retail support website (retailsupport.screenbeam.com).
  • Warranty: The product comes with a one-year Limited Hardware Warranty and 90-day free software updates from the date of purchase. Specific legal rights may vary by region.
